Rare Double Barrelled Percussion Pistol With Sliding Rear Sight & Hidden Triggers, C.1840–1865.

£650    $878    €748
A good original example of a mid-19th century over-and-under percussion pistol, dating from circa 1840–1865. Of compact form with twin superposed barrels and double external hammers, the pistol is fitted with a walnut grip and plain chequered lock plates, consistent with continental manufacture of the period. Notably, it retains its uncommon sliding rear sight, which retracts neatly beneath the hammer line — a feature not typically encountered on standard pocket examples. The metalwork shows an even, untouched patina with light age-related oxidation, and the walnut grip displays honest handling wear. The action is reported to be in working order, enhancing its desirability as a mechanically complete period piece.
